General Description

Each isolator in this series consists of an infrared emi ng diode and a NPN silicon phototransistor, which are mounted in a herme cally sealed TO‐78 package.

Devices are designed for military and/or harsh environments.

The suffix le er “A” denotes the collector is electrically isolated from the case.

Key Features

  •  TO-78 hermetically sealed package.
  •  High current transfer ratio.
  •  1 kV electrical isolation.
  •  Base contact provided for conventional transistor biasing.
  •  TX and TXV devices processed to MIL-PRF-19500.
